Exploring Greenland Supermarket: A Shopper’s Paradise

Located on Stephanie Street, Greenland Supermarket is a veritable treasure trove of Asian ingredients. This large supermarket boasts an extensive selection of products from across Asia, making it a one-stop shop for anyone seeking to explore a wide range of culinary traditions. Upon entering, you’re immediately greeted by the vibrant colors and enticing aromas of fresh produce, seafood, and spices. Greenland Supermarket’s strength lies in its comprehensive inventory. You’ll find everything from fresh bok choy, gai lan, and choy sum to a wide array of exotic fruits like durian, mangosteen, and jackfruit. The seafood section is particularly impressive, featuring live fish, crabs, and other crustaceans, as well as a variety of frozen and dried seafood products. Meat lovers will appreciate the selection of premium cuts of beef, pork, and poultry, including specialty items like Korean short ribs and Chinese roast duck.

Beyond the fresh produce and meat departments, Greenland Supermarket offers a vast selection of pantry staples, including rice, noodles, sauces, spices, and condiments. You can find countless varieties of soy sauce, fish sauce, chili paste, and other essential ingredients for Asian cooking. The store also carries a wide range of imported snacks, beverages, and sweets, perfect for satisfying any craving. One of the highlights of Greenland Supermarket is its prepared food section. Here, you can find a variety of freshly made dishes, including dim sum, sushi, roasted meats, and noodle soups. These ready-to-eat meals are a convenient option for busy individuals who want to enjoy authentic Asian cuisine without the hassle of cooking. The atmosphere at Greenland Supermarket is typically bustling and lively, with a mix of shoppers from various ethnic backgrounds. The staff is generally friendly and helpful, and the store is well-organized and clean. Greenland Supermarket caters to a broad range of customers, from experienced Asian cooks to curious foodies looking to explore new flavors. Its sheer size and variety make it a destination for anyone seeking authentic Asian ingredients in Henderson.

A Taste of Korea at Arirang Market

Arirang Market, situated off Eastern Avenue, offers a distinctly Korean culinary experience. Specializing in Korean groceries and prepared foods, this market provides a taste of home for the local Korean community and a fascinating exploration for anyone interested in Korean cuisine. Stepping into Arirang Market is like stepping into a small slice of Seoul. The shelves are stocked with a wide variety of Korean ingredients, from the essential gochujang (chili paste) and doenjang (fermented soybean paste) to a wide array of Korean snacks, beverages, and instant noodles. The fresh produce section features a selection of Korean vegetables, such as Korean radish, napa cabbage, and perilla leaves. Meat lovers will appreciate the selection of thinly sliced beef and pork, perfect for grilling Korean barbecue.

Arirang Market truly shines with its prepared food section, offering a tempting array of Korean dishes. You can find classic dishes like bibimbap, bulgogi, japchae, and kimchi jjigae, all made fresh daily. The market also sells a variety of Korean banchan (side dishes), such as kimchi, pickled vegetables, and marinated seaweed. These small dishes are a staple of Korean cuisine and are perfect for adding variety and flavor to any meal. The atmosphere at Arirang Market is warm and inviting, with a strong sense of community. The staff is incredibly friendly and helpful, and they are always happy to answer questions about Korean ingredients and cooking techniques. Arirang Market caters primarily to the Korean community in Henderson, but it also welcomes anyone who is interested in exploring Korean cuisine. The market’s authentic products, delicious prepared foods, and friendly atmosphere make it a must-visit destination for anyone seeking a taste of Korea. It’s more than just a market; it’s a cultural touchstone.

Island Pacific Supermarket: A Filipino Fiesta

Bringing the flavors of the Philippines to Henderson, Island Pacific Supermarket is a vibrant hub for Filipino groceries and cuisine. Located on Warm Springs Road, this market offers a comprehensive selection of products that cater to the Filipino community while introducing the unique tastes of the Philippines to a wider audience. The moment you enter Island Pacific Supermarket, you’re greeted by the sounds of Filipino music and the delicious aromas of Filipino cooking. The produce section features familiar fruits and vegetables alongside uniquely Filipino items like malunggay (moringa leaves), ube (purple yam), and banana blossoms. The meat department boasts a wide variety of pork cuts, essential for Filipino dishes like adobo and lechon.

Island Pacific Supermarket truly excels in its offering of Filipino pantry staples. You’ll find a wide variety of Filipino sauces, spices, and condiments, including soy sauce, vinegar, patis (fish sauce), and bagoong (shrimp paste). The market also stocks a large selection of Filipino snacks, sweets, and beverages, including polvoron, pastillas, and halo-halo. The star of Island Pacific Supermarket is undoubtedly its in-house restaurant and prepared food section. Here, you can sample a wide range of classic Filipino dishes, including adobo, sinigang, lechon, pancit, and lumpia. The food is freshly made daily and offers a delicious and convenient way to experience the flavors of the Philippines. The atmosphere at Island Pacific Supermarket is lively and festive, reflecting the warm and welcoming culture of the Philippines. The staff is incredibly friendly and helpful, and the market often hosts special events and promotions to celebrate Filipino holidays. Island Pacific Supermarket is a central gathering place for the Filipino community in Henderson, providing a taste of home and a connection to their cultural heritage. It is also an excellent destination for anyone looking to discover the delicious and diverse cuisine of the Philippines.

Navigating the Markets: Insider Tips and Recommendations

When planning your visit, consider that the best times to visit for the freshest produce and seafood are typically early in the morning, especially on weekends. This is when the markets receive their new shipments and you’ll have the widest selection to choose from. While most markets have English-speaking staff, don’t hesitate to use translation apps or bring a phrasebook if you’re unsure about a particular ingredient. Pointing and gesturing are also perfectly acceptable!

When it comes to selecting produce, look for items that are firm, brightly colored, and free from blemishes. For seafood, check for clear eyes, a fresh smell, and firm flesh. Don’t be afraid to ask the staff for advice – they are usually experts in their products and can offer valuable tips. Some must-try items include the various types of kimchi at Korean markets, the fresh spring rolls at Vietnamese markets, and the wide variety of sauces and spices at Chinese markets. With a little planning, you can create a delicious and authentic Asian meal using ingredients sourced directly from these Henderson gems.
